R. Scott Morris

Chief Investment Strategist at Blackthorne Capital Management

The focus of Scott Morris’ more than 30 year’s of experience in the financial markets has been developing quantitative models and automated trading strategies. His market expertise spans many asset classes including commodities, equities, bonds, futures, and options.

Morris served in a number of leadership positions including CEO of the Boston Options Exchange, Managing Director at Goldman Sachs, Partner at Hull Trading Company, Head of Quantitative Research at Ronin Capital, and President of Morris Consulting. He has taught Corporate and Entrepreneurial Finance at University of Wisconsin-Whitewater and lectured at many prestigious universities including Carnegie Mellon, University of Chicago and Stanford. He has also spoken at numerous educational and industry events sponsored by organizations including the Futures Industry Association, Security Traders Association, Markets Media, OptionCity, Options Industry Conference and the High Frequency Traders Leadership Forum.

Morris is a graduate of the University of Chicago with an AB degree in Economics and an MBA in Finance and Statistics.
